# frozen_string_literal: true
RSpec.shared_examples 'work item base types importer' do
it "creates all base work item types if they don't exist" do
WorkItems::Type.delete_all
expect { subject }.to change { WorkItems::Type.count }.from(0).to(WorkItems::Type::BASE_TYPES.count)
types_in_db = WorkItems::Type.all.map { |type| type.slice(:base_type, :icon_name, :name).symbolize_keys }
expected_types = WorkItems::Type::BASE_TYPES.map do |type, attributes|
attributes.slice(:icon_name, :name).merge(base_type: type.to_s)
end
expect(types_in_db).to match_array(expected_types)
expect(WorkItems::Type.all).to all(be_valid)
end
it 'creates all default widget definitions' do
WorkItems::WidgetDefinition.delete_all
widget_mapping = ::Gitlab::DatabaseImporters::WorkItems::BaseTypeImporter::WIDGETS_FOR_TYPE
expect { subject }.to change { WorkItems::WidgetDefinition.count }.from(0).to(widget_mapping.values.flatten.count)
created_widgets = WorkItems::WidgetDefinition.global.map do |widget|
{ name: widget.work_item_type.name, type: widget.widget_type }
end
expected_widgets = widget_mapping.flat_map do |type_sym, widget_types|
widget_types.map { |type| { name: ::WorkItems::Type::TYPE_NAMES[type_sym], type: type.to_s } }
end
expect(created_widgets).to match_array(expected_widgets)
end
it 'upserts base work item types if they already exist' do
first_type = WorkItems::Type.first
original_name = first_type.name
first_type.update!(name: original_name.upcase)
expect do
subject
first_type.reload
end.to not_change(WorkItems::Type, :count).and(
change { first_type.name }.from(original_name.upcase).to(original_name)
)
end
it 'upserts default widget definitions if they already exist and type changes' do
widget = WorkItems::WidgetDefinition.global.find_by_widget_type(:labels)
widget.update!(widget_type: :weight)
expect do
subject
widget.reload
end.to not_change(WorkItems::WidgetDefinition, :count).and(
change { widget.widget_type }.from('weight').to('labels')
)
end
it 'does not change default widget definitions if they already exist with changed disabled status' do
widget = WorkItems::WidgetDefinition.global.find_by_widget_type(:labels)
widget.update!(disabled: true)
expect do
subject
widget.reload
end.to not_change(WorkItems::WidgetDefinition, :count).and(
not_change { widget.disabled }
)
end
it 'executes single INSERT query per types and widget definitions' do
expect { subject }.to make_queries_matching(/INSERT/, 2)
end
context 'when some base types exist' do
before do
WorkItems::Type.limit(1).delete_all
end
it 'inserts all types and does nothing if some already existed' do
expect { subject }.to make_queries_matching(/INSERT/, 2).and(
change { WorkItems::Type.count }.by(1)
)
expect(WorkItems::Type.count).to eq(WorkItems::Type::BASE_TYPES.count)
end
end
context 'when some widget definitions exist' do
before do
WorkItems::WidgetDefinition.limit(1).delete_all
end
it 'inserts all widget definitions and does nothing if some already existed' do
expect { subject }.to make_queries_matching(/INSERT/, 2).and(
change { WorkItems::WidgetDefinition.count }.by(1)
)
end
end
end
